Аннотация:The process of expanding of two-component gaseous mixture was studied in a stageof a turboexpander unit in three-dimensional unsteady setting with use of methods of computerfluid dynamics. The calculation method used in this work made it possible to study theturboexpander unit in a single calculation model but not in parts due to the use of slidinginterfaces. Based on the distribution of the supersaturation ratio, assumption was made about thepossible localization of phase transitions in the flow part of the stage of the turboexpander unit,confirmed by the characteristic impeller damage.
